Output 8babdfd279d4f1d8508c4127bdfc7c9f2e5f00bdef4d5c91d595e997fdefa5aa:3

value
6872774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8559b38cb7e68d417367e74b85d7a766fa8f791f OP_EQUAL
address
3Dr7Fcm5qB461GKnkgyUiumTjWjh7ViaL7
transaction
8babdfd279d4f1d8508c4127bdfc7c9f2e5f00bdef4d5c91d595e997fdefa5aa
spent
true